Update Regarding Masses & Parish Office Reopening

As reported previously, a member of our parish staff tested positive for COVID 19.  Immediately after learning of this positive test, our parish priests and parish office staff who were in close contact began to quarantine.  After five days, those in quarantine took a COVID test.  Both Father Fisher and Father Bergida tested positive.  Father Fisher and Father Bergida are currently experiencing no symptoms of the virus.

After consultation with the diocese and the Fairfax County Health Department, Father Fisher and Father Bergida will continue to quarantine and follow all CDC guidelines and protocols.

The church and parish offices were cleaned and sanitized immediately after the first report of the parish office having COVID.

At this time, we will continue to have daily Masses and Confessions with visiting priests.

The parish offices will reopen on Tuesday, February 2 with Parish Office staff.  Father Fisher and Father Bergida look forward to returning as soon as they can. We conclude, by asking all of you to please continue praying for our parish, all who are sick, and all those who care for the sick.
